Why These Are the Top BMW Repair Auto Repair Shops in Drew

** The BMW repair market in and around Drew, Mississippi, is characteristic of a rural area. There are no dealerships or shops that advertise as *exclusive* BMW specialists within the city itself. The market is served by a handful of competent general auto repair shops in nearby towns like Cleveland (a 15-minute drive) and Clarksdale (a 30-minute drive). For highly specialized work—such as complex iDrive diagnostics, advanced xDrive issues, or performance tuning—residents typically travel to larger metropolitan areas like Jackson or Memphis. The average quality of service for standard maintenance is good at the local level, but the competition for specialized German auto repair is low. Pricing is generally more affordable than in major cities, but true expertise for complex BMW systems commands a premium and is the primary differentiator between the top providers listed. Are BMW repairs more expensive in Drew, MS, compared to standard cars, and what's a typical price range for common services?

Yes, BMW repairs are typically more expensive due to specialized parts and technician expertise. In Drew, common services like oil changes can range from $120-$200, while brake jobs often start around $400-$800 per axle. Always request a detailed estimate upfront from the local shop.

What are the most common BMW repair issues you see for vehicles driven on Mississippi Delta roads around Drew?

Given the region's flat but sometimes rough rural roads, we frequently see suspension component wear (struts, control arms) and issues related to heat and humidity, such as cooling system failures and electrical sensor malfunctions. These are common in many BMW models driven locally.

Are there any local driving conditions in Drew that require specific attention for my BMW?

Yes, the combination of high summer heat, humidity, and occasional dusty rural roads can stress your BMW's cooling system, air filtration, and exterior finish. We recommend more frequent coolant system checks and regular cabin air filter changes to combat these local environmental factors.
